1. Hotel Ivy, a Luxury Collection Hotel, Minneapolis (4-star hotel)

About this hotel

In downtown Minneapolis, this contemporary, upscale hotel lies a 4-minute walk from Minneapolis Convention Center and 10 miles from Minneapolis−Saint Paul International Airport.Plush rooms and suites come with flat-screen TVs, free Wi-Fi and sitting areas, plus luxurious limestone bathrooms. Some suites have wet bars, while the 2-story penthouse suites has a dining room and office area.Dining options include a sleek lobby bar and a posh bar/restaurant, which serves cocktails and classic Italian fare. There’s also a fitness center, spa (fee) and business center with meeting rooms. Parking is available for a fee.

2. InterContinental Minneapolis – St. Paul Airport (4-star hotel)

About this hotel

Set inside the Minneapolis−Saint Paul International Airport, this upscale airport hotel is 4 miles from the Mall of America and 5 miles from the picturesque Minnehaha Park.Polished rooms and suites offer free Wi-Fi, flat-screen TVs and minibars, plus sitting areas and coffeemakers.There are 3 contemporary restaurants, a spa and an indoor pool, plus event facilities. Parking is available for a fee.

5. Rand Tower Hotel, Minneapolis, a Marriott Tribute Portfolio Hotel

About this hotel

In a 1920s Art Deco building in Downtown, this posh hotel is a 7-minute walk from the Target Center events venue and a 10-minute walk from the Orpheum Theater. It’s 1 mile from Interstate 394.Stylish, vintage-chic rooms have Wi-Fi, flat-screen TVs and coffeemakers. Suites add sofabeds; upgraded suites feature separate living rooms.There’s a glamorous restaurant/cocktail bar, as well as 2 elegant lounges (1 with a retractable roof; 1 with aviator-themed decor). Breakfast is available.

6. Renaissance Minneapolis Hotel, The Depot (4-star hotel)

About this hotel

Set in a historic train depot in downtown Minneapolis, this polished hotel is less than a mile from Target Field stadium and 2 miles from the Minneapolis Institute of Arts.Rooms range from classy rooms to polished suites with living rooms, pull-out sofas and dining areas. All of the rooms feature free Wi-Fi, flat-screens, coffeemakers and minifridges. Select rooms add access to a club lounge with free breakfast and snacks. Room service is available.There’s an American-style restaurant/bar and a gift shop. Other amenities include a gym, a business center and 11 meeting rooms.
